The size of Leura is approximately 11.1 square kilometres. There are 16 parks, covering nearly 9.3% of the total area. The population of Leura in 2016 was 4644 people. By 2021 the population was 4503 showing a population decline of 3.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Leura is 60-69 years. Households in Leura are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Leura work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 75.00% of the homes in Leura were owner-occupied compared with 73.60% in 2016.
